jonnylangefeld / shim
The most user friendly dependency injection library for go
☆12Updated 8 months ago
Alternatives and similar repositories for shim:
Users that are interested in shim are comparing it to the libraries listed below
- ☆16Updated 10 months ago
- Embedded cache lib using sqlite for storage☆19Updated 5 months ago
- Communicating with NATS using the HTTP protocol.☆17Updated 9 months ago
- livegollection is a Golang library for live data synchronization between backend and frontend of a custom user-implemented collection. It…☆23Updated 3 years ago
- Go implementation of Bitcask - A Log-Structured Hash Table for Fast Key / Value Data☆35Updated last year
- MyJSON is an embedded relational document store built on top of pluggable key value storage☆14Updated 2 years ago
- Pure Go Permanent Storage For Open Telemetry Metrics, Traces and Logs, based on Compressed Roaring B-Tree Bitmaps, using Typescript as Q…☆16Updated 11 months ago
- tail files with inotify☆23Updated last year
- Immutable Adaptive Radix Tree implementation in go☆20Updated 7 months ago
- Type-safe, automatic, asynchronous batch processing.☆18Updated 9 months ago
- A Protobuf IDL parser for Go☆16Updated this week
- go2 generics experiment in building generic augmented BTree data structures☆24Updated 3 years ago
- An inverted bitmap index written in Go.☆27Updated last year
- Scheduler of events for near real-time systems☆24Updated last year
- Agentic AI workers explicitly in Go☆12Updated last month
- Global defers for Go.☆17Updated 3 months ago
- HTTP Middleware library for TinyGo used to compile WebAssembly Guest modules☆22Updated last year
- Mutex with FIFO lock acquisition☆11Updated 11 months ago
- streaming, buffered table encoder for result sets (ie from a database)☆21Updated 3 weeks ago
- High performance approximate algorithms in Go (e.g. morris counter, count min, etc.)☆15Updated last year
- A library that implements a family of low-level tools to build persistent messaging systems.☆12Updated 3 years ago
- Go module for fetching embeddings from embeddings providers☆51Updated last week
- Prints a list of all runtime/metrics and their properties.☆12Updated last year
- A worker pool which processes work in parallel but outputs results in the order the work was given☆14Updated 5 months ago
- Simple internal event bus for Go applications☆30Updated last year
- Go implementation of variance's method for one-pass variance computation with D. H. D. West improved methods which features merging of se…☆16Updated last year
- A.P.O. - "Authorized Personnel Only" is a minimalist OAuth IAM written in Go☆36Updated 2 years ago
- Helpful pipeline functionality with generics and channels.☆14Updated last year
- A powerful and intuitive Go package designed for handling date intervals efficiently and effectively. This library simplifies operations …☆16Updated 3 weeks ago
- A Go library implementation of LightRAG - an advanced Retrieval-Augmented Generation (RAG) system that uniquely combines vector databases…☆14Updated this week